Jack Leiter Logs Seven Innings on Sunday

Share:
Link copied to clipboard!
See RotoBaller at the top of Google

May 19, 2025, 7:21 AM ET

Texas Rangers starting pitcher Jack Leiter tossed seven innings of three-run ball against the Houston Astros on Sunday afternoon. Leiter carried a no-hitter into the seventh inning. However, Astros catcher Yainer Diaz hit a solo shot to end the bid. Then in the eighth, Leiter allowed two singles to Jake Meyers and Cam Smith before exiting the game. Relief pitcher Robert Garcia would then allow a three-run shot to Isaac Paredes, which raised Leiter's ERA. The former second overall pick has shown flashes of dominance this season but has also had several disappointing showings. He has allowed more than four runs twice and allowed three or more walks in three starts. Through 36 total innings, the right-hander carries a 4.25 ERA with a 1.11 WHIP. He will look to continue this strong run against the White Sox in his next outing.--Andy Smith
